A TMT: Pushing Our Understanding of Exoplanets and Cosmology

The Thirty Meter Telescope (TMT) stands as a monumental achievement in astronomical engineering, poised to revolutionize our comprehension of the cosmos. With its unprecedented light-gathering power, TMT will peer deeper into the universe than ever before, unlocking secrets hidden within distant galaxies and exoplanetary systems. By analyzing faint celestial objects, TMT will shed light on read more the formation and evolution of stars, galaxies, and even the earliest stages of the universe. Moreover, its high-resolution capabilities will enable astronomers to characterize the atmospheres of exoplanets, searching for signs of habitability and potentially discovering evidence of extraterrestrial life.

Moreover, TMT's innovative design will facilitate groundbreaking research in cosmology. By measuring the properties of distant supernovae and gravitational lensing effects, astronomers can test fundamental theories about the nature of dark energy and the expansion of the universe. The wealth of data collected by TMT will undoubtedly revolutionize our understanding of the cosmos, inspiring new generations of scientists to explore the vast unknown.

Peering into the Cosmos: The Thirty Meter Telescope

The Thirty Meter Telescope (TMT) stands poised to revolutionize our understanding of the universe. Scheduled for completion in the upcoming decade, this massive observatory will be the largest optical/infrared telescope on Earth. Located atop Mauna Kea in Hawaii, TMT's remarkable light-gathering power will allow astronomers to probe the universe with unprecedented clarity.

From observing distant galaxies and searching for exoplanets, to unveiling the mysteries of dark matter and illuminating the origins of the universe, TMT promises a abundance of scientific breakthroughs.

Its advanced technology will enable observations in wavelengths currently inaccessible to other telescopes, paving the way for entirely new discoveries. The knowledge gained from TMT will transform our understanding of our place in the cosmos and inspire future generations of astronomers.
